Abstract
PURPOSE:To improve the electric characteristic of a unit, by setting the maximum output voltage of the first rectifying circuit between the maximum output voltage of the second rectifying circuit and the DC bias voltage in the suppression type signal receiver used in the in-band single frequency signal system. CONSTITUTION:Differential and integral amplifying circuit 10 has a feedback system and sets the gain to a value lower than the gain of the IF in the low frequency and the high frequency of the sound band, and the output of circuit 10 is sent to active band-pass filter 20. The output of filter 20 is rectified in 30, and the input and the output of filter 20 are subjected to summing amplification by voltage adding circuit 40, and the gain for the output signal of filter 20 in the centre frequency is so set that the gain above may be lower than the gain for the input signal by voltage gain components of filter 20. The output is rectified by rectifying circuit 50, and a constsnt DC bias voltage is applied to this rectified output, and output voltages of circuits 30 and 50 are compared with each other in 60, and the maximum output voltage of circuit 30 is set between the maximum output voltage of circuit 50 and the DC bias voltage, thus improving the electric characteristic of the unit.
